Mastering proficiency in the English language to score higher and succeed in varying degrees of life

Kuwait, 18 August 2019:   Owing to growing demand for IELTS (International English Language Testing System) in the country, the British Council, one of the co-creators of IELTS, is offering the world’s most widely recognised English proficiency test. Backed by acceptance from worldwide universities, British Council helps participants reach the required level through training in four sections: reading, writing, listening and speaking skills. 

British Council has deployed internationally trained English experts adept in IELTS exams, to help students learn test-taking strategies to help maximise their test results, receive feedback on individual strengths and areas needing improvement through practice tasks. As the Ministry of Higher Education is open for scholarships presently, students can use the opportunity to advance themselves to receive the required scores. Teenagers or adults interested in pursuing diverse prospects can apply under different levels ranging from pre-intermediate, intermediate and upper-intermediate, depending on the stage of proficiency required. 

The IELTS Academic test measures whether one has the level of English language proficiency needed for an academic environment. Additionally, it reflects some of the features of the academic language and assesses whether they are ready to begin studying or training. British Council encourages individuals to take the test if they want to study at an undergraduate level anywhere in the world, apply for Tier 4 Student Visa at a university or work in a professional organisation.

Moreover, one can choose between paper-based or computer-delivered IELTS Academic for added convenience backed by the option of several dates to choose from and quicker response on results than any other. British Council is committed to providing all with the support needed to acquire the essential test results, through the provision of free unlimited access to ‘Road to IELTS’ Last Minute course.

The course includes nine videos which gives advice and tutorials, 100 interactive activities and two IELTS Academic practice tests for each of the four skills. Accommodating every step of the education journey, participants can find preparation materials such as videos and online lessons, as well as preparation books, face-to-face courses, seminars and workshops.

Group classes will be held twice a week for the 35 hours IELTS Preparation course and for the IELTS Intensive courses classes, it will be held daily for four days a week. Students are provided with two options wherein they can either apply to August course which runs from 22 to 31 August 2019 for the 30-hour course or opt for the 10 hours IELTS Intensive courses which occurs every week, for 10 hours throughout the month of August. Students can apply for the exams directly after completing their preparation course.
             
Ensuring easier and quicker access, individuals interested in applying for the IELTS test can now pay online for their IELTS Test using their master/visa credit card.
